Bringinging Your Own Device: The Freedom to Choose
United Airlines’ decision to shift towards a BYOD (Bring Your Own Device) entertainment system marks a significant departure from traditional in-flight entertainment. This move grants passengers the freedom to choose their preferred devices, allowing them to access a wide range of content on their personal devices. This shift acknowledges the reality that many travelers already bring their devices on board, and it’s a nod to the growing trend of personalized in-flight experiences.
By embracing BYOD, United Airlines is catering to passengers’ diverse preferences and habits. Whether you’re an avid gamer, a binge-watcher, or an avid reader, you can now enjoy your favorite content on your own device. This flexibility is particularly appealing to frequent flyers who value the ability to customize their in-flight experience.

The Cons: Inconvenience and Inequality
Leaving Some Passengers Behind: The Digital Divide
While the BYOD system offers numerous benefits, it also raises concerns about the digital divide. Not all passengers have access to personal devices or the means to purchase or rent content. This could lead to a situation where some passengers are left without access to in-flight entertainment, potentially exacerbating feelings of inequality and isolation.
Furthermore, the shift towards BYOD may disproportionately affect certain demographics, such as low-income families, seniors, or those living in areas with limited access to digital technology. United Airlines must consider these groups and provide alternative solutions to ensure that all passengers have access to some form of in-flight entertainment.
The Burden of Battery Life: A New Travel Concern
The BYOD system also introduces a new concern for passengers: battery life. With the average flight duration exceeding 2 hours, passengers must now worry about their devices running out of power mid-flight. This could lead to frustration and disappointment, especially for passengers who rely on their devices for entertainment or work.
United Airlines can mitigate this issue by providing power outlets or USB ports on board, allowing passengers to keep their devices charged. However, this may not be a feasible solution for all aircraft, and passengers must be prepared to take matters into their own hands by packing portable power banks and chargers.
